请分析CFB工作模式中密文缺失或插入一个分组的情况
时间: 2023-05-30 07:06:04 浏览: 180
加密分组模式说明(ECB\CBC\CFB\OFB)
CFB工作模式是一种分组密码的加密模式,它将明文分成固定长度的分组,每次加密前一个分组的密文作为下一个分组加密的输入,这样可以产生一个连续的密文流。
在CFB工作模式中,如果密文缺失或插入一个分组,会导致解密出现错误。具体来说,如果密文缺失一个分组,那么解密时前一个分组的密文就无法作为下一个分组的输入,解密出的明文就会出现错误。如果密文插入一个分组,那么解密时会将插入的密文当作下一个分组的输入,导致解密出的明文也会出现错误。
因此,在使用CFB工作模式时,必须确保密文的完整性和正确性,避免出现密文缺失或插入的情况。可以使用错误检测和纠错技术来保证密文的完整性和正确性,例如使用CRC校验码或前向纠错码等。此外,还可以使用其他更加可靠的加密模式,如CTR或GCM模式来替代CFB模式。
阅读全文